What Is Dihydrocodeine 30mg?
Dihydrocodeine is an opioid analgesic that works by affecting how your brain and nervous system perceive pain. It’s commonly prescribed for:
Post-surgical pain
Chronic back pain
Severe joint or muscle pain
Pain caused by nerve damage (neuropathic pain)
It may also be used in combination with other medications in certain cases.
Is It Legal to Buy Dihydrocodeine 30mg Online in the UK?
Yes, it is legal to buy Dihydrocodeine online in the UK, but only from registered and regulated online pharmacies. You must have a valid prescription to purchase this medication legally. In the UK, dihydrocodeine is classified as a Prescription Only Medicine (POM) and is also a controlled drug under the Misuse of Drugs Act.

Possible Side Effects of Dihydrocodeine
Like all opioids, Dihydrocodeine comes with risks and potential side effects, including:
Drowsiness or dizziness
Constipation
Nausea or vomiting
Headaches
Dry mouth
Dependence or addiction (with long-term use)
Always follow your doctor's instructions and never exceed the recommended dose.
Important Warnings and Precautions
Do not drive or operate heavy machinery if you feel drowsy after taking Dihydrocodeine.
Avoid alcohol, as it can increase drowsiness and the risk of overdose.
Inform your doctor if you have a history of asthma, liver disease, or drug dependence.
Do not stop taking Dihydrocodeine suddenly—your doctor may need to reduce your dose gradually.
